Заказал вот такой комплект: Тык, не могу разобраться как подключить приемник к Меге, пробовал примеры из разных библиотек, в мониторе порта тишина.Но если цифровой порт перевести в режим чтения, то неистово бегут 0 и 1, отсюда сделал вывод что приемник рабочий и что-то принимает.
@Пушной звер У меня имеется всего одна мега и погодный датчик,который шлет каждые 40 секунд информацию на частоте 433,92,провод данных подключаю к 2 цифровому пину,пытаюсь отловить ее вот таким кодом: Код (C++): #include <RCSwitch.h> RCSwitch mySwitch = RCSwitch(); void setup(){ Serial.begin(9600); mySwitch.enableReceive(0); Serial.println("Scanning 433,9Mhz "); } void loop() { if (mySwitch.available()) { int value = mySwitch.getReceivedValue(); if (value == 0) { Serial.print("Unknown encoding"); } else { Serial.print("Received "); Serial.print( mySwitch.getReceivedValue() ); Serial.print("/ "); Serial.print( mySwitch.getReceivedBitlength() ); Serial.print("bit "); Serial.print("Protocol: "); Serial.println( mySwitch.getReceivedProtocol() ); } mySwitch.resetAvailable(); } } Но в ответ тишина. Как еще можно проверить работоспособность приемника?
нуда, тутже все телепаты. он там может слать в своем формате, на определенной скорости, откуда инфа что RCSwitch те данные должн понимать?